Masha Tiplady

Masha Tiplady is an Edinburgh-based fine art printmaker and founder of “Masha and the prints”. She grew up in Moscow and moved to Scotland  20 years ago to complete her Master’s degree.

Masha is a self-taught printmaker. Before becoming a self-employed artist she spent quarter of a century gaining 3 non-creative degrees and doing a variety of office-based  jobs.
She discovered linocut by pure chance, while she was looking for things to help her cope with post-natal anxiety, following the birth of her baby daughter. Linocut was love from the first sight and what started as a hobby/art therapy quickly became Masha’s happy place, passion and full-time occupation.

Masha works from her home studio and makes all of her prints using traditional printmaking techniques.
Masha is an active member of Edinburgh Printmakers studios, where she continues to learn and develop various printmaking techniques, such as intaglio and lithography.
She also regularly runs linocut workshops for beginners and people wishing to refresh their printmaking skills.
